Transaction 08e7587bf93b8a318c1c745f0ec3f486808745e7517a630e49a724dfdee34b02

2 Input
1 Outputs
  • 08e7587bf93b8a318c1c745f0ec3f486808745e7517a630e49a724dfdee34b02:0
  • value  25328
    address  165vVHWW79Gx9HcYGfcVLHiZfvZsmcoF7F